WHAT IS DELTA 8 THC?
Delta-8 and delta-9 THC are two of over 100 cannabinoids produced by hemp plants. You probably noticed that both delta-8 and delta-9 end in THC. What does that mean?
Delta-8 and delta-9-THC differ only in the placement of their 2-carbon double bond. Delta-8 has its double bond in the 8th position and delta-9 has a double bond in the 9th.
The close similarities give delta-8 THC a euphoric effect similar to delta-9, although delta-8 is less potent than delta-9. The differences have led to some confusion about the legal status of delta 8 products under delta 8 laws in Texas.
DELTA 8 VS DELTA 9
Delta-8-THC and delta-9-THC are two forms of tetrahydrocannabinol, an oily molecule produced by cannabis plants.
Delta-9 THC is the primary psychoactive chemical in marijuana, but it is just one of over 113 (and counting!) cannabinoids found in a cannabis plant. Most of those other cannabinoids are produced in smaller quantities, but many have potent medicinal effects of their own.
Delta-8-THC differs from delta-9-THC only in the placement of the double bond that helps the THC molecule hook up to your body’s cannabinoid receptors. But that placement makes delta-8 react less strongly with those receptors than delta-9, hence delta-8’s lower potency.
IS DELTA 8 LEGAL IN TEXAS
Delta 8 laws in Texas are still in a very gray area that has yet to be settled in court.
At present there is no Texas law declaring delta-8-THC illegal. There were efforts to list delta-8 as a Schedule 1 substance like delta-9-THC. But after retail merchants got a delta 8 injunction, Texas Health & Human Services lost the appeal. Legislative efforts to declare delta-8 illegal have been unsuccessful so far, but the final verdict still remains unsettled.

Why is Delta 8 Legal in Texas
Is delta 8 THC legal in Texas? Under the 2018 Farm Bill, hemp and hemp byproducts other than delta-9-THC were declared legal under federal law. But as delta-8 became more popular, Texas HHS officials declared delta-8 a Schedule 1 controlled substance.
The delta-8 injunction was temporary pending a January 2022 hearing. But that hearing was canceled and has not yet been rescheduled. Delta-8 products are legal for now but delta 8 laws in Texas remain unsettled.
HOW THE 2018 FARM BILL HELPED
The 2018 Farm Bill separated “hemp” from “marijuana” and legalized hemp – Cannabis sativa material with less than 0.3% delta-9-THC – nationwide. This effectively covered all cannabinoids, acids, isomers, salts, and salts of isomers.
In October 2021 Texas Health and Human Services declared delta-8 a Schedule 1 Controlled Substance. Schedule 1 is reserved for drugs like heroin with no accepted medical use. Violating Schedule 1 delta 8 laws in Texas could lead to fines or prison.
After you look at the original text below, read on for a Delta 8 THC Texas update.
Sec. 121.001.
Texas Agriculture Code states: “hemp” means the plant Cannabis sativa L. and any part of that plant, including the seeds of the plant and all derivatives, extracts, cannabinoids, isomers, acids, salts, and salts of isomers, whether growing or not, with a delta-9 tetrahydrocannabinol concentration of not more than 0.3 percent on a dry weight basis.
Merchants and users believed this made delta-8 legal in Texas.
Sec. 481.002.
Texas Health & Safety Code states: (5) “Controlled substance” means a substance, including a drug, an adulterant, and a dilutant, listed in Schedules I through V or Penalty Group 1, 1-A, 2, 2-A, 3, or 4. The term includes the aggregate weight of any mixture, solution, or other substance containing a controlled substance. The term does not include hemp, as defined by Section 121.001, Agriculture Code, or the tetrahydrocannabinols in hemp.
Let’s look at how Texas defines the term Marihuana:
(26) “Marihuana” means the plant Cannabis sativa L., whether growing or not, the seeds of that plant, and every compound, manufacture, salt, derivative, mixture, or preparation of that plant or its seeds.
While federal law might make delta-8 legal, Texas HHS argued that delta-8-THC’s psychoactive properties were close enough to delta-9-THC to warrant the scheduling.
Will Delta 8 Continue to Be Legal?
The injunction against the HHS decision was sustained on appeal and at the Texas Supreme Court. But the battle is not over. Many legislators are pushing for delta 8 laws in Texas that would make the sale and possession of delta-8 products illegal.

Is Delta 9 THC Legal in Texas
Is Delta 9 legal in Texas? Only in very small amounts. Texas Health and Safety Code Chapter 443 allows Consumable Hemp Products in Texas that do not exceed 0.3% Delta-9 tetrahydrocannabinol (THC). Any higher quantities of delta-9 and your legal hemp becomes illegal marijuana. In Texas possession of up to two ounces of marijuana is punishable by up to 180 days in jail, a $2,000 fine, or both.

Driving Under the Influence
If an officer determines you were driving while under the influence of delta-8, Texas will charge you with DWI (Driving While Impaired).
A DWI conviction in Texas will cost you up to $2,000 in fines and between 3 and 180 days in jail.
You will also face a license suspension of up to a year and increased insurance premiums. And things get even worse if you have an earlier DWI on your record.

Bond
If you are currently facing charges and are out on a bond, the judge will tell you that you cannot have any cannabinoids. That means Delta 8 as well as cannabis. Delta 8 in Texas is legal for now, but if you fail a court-mandated drug test for cannabinoids or are caught with delta-8 products, you can be returned to jail for violating the terms of your bond.
Probation
Your probation includes a stipulations warning that says you cannot possess or consume any cannabinoids, including delta 8 in Texas. Delta-8 metabolites will trigger a positive cannabinoid test and could very well put you behind bars. If you are presently on supervised probation, delta 8 will get you in just as much trouble as marijuana. Don’t risk your freedom.
